1. PHP / Говнокод #16844

    +161

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    if (in_array($str, array('1', '2', '3', '4', '5', '6', '7', '8', '9', '10', '11', '12'))) {
        return TRUE;
    } else {
        $this->error = "Значение поля 'Месяц' содержит некорректное значение";
        return FALSE;
    }

    Запостил: AgentSIB, 13 Октября 2014

    Комментарии (4) RSS

    • if (in_array($str, array('1', '2', '3', ... '2014'))) {
          return TRUE;
      } else {
          $this->error = "Значение поля 'Год' содержит некорректное значение";
          return FALSE;
      }
      Ответить
      • Дык это тоже есть... Чуть ниже.. И еще несколько подобных... .
        if (in_array($str, array('2013', '2014', '2015'))) {
            return TRUE;
         } else {
            $this->error = "Значение поля 'Год' содержит некорректное значение";
            return FALSE;
        }
        Ответить
      • И select во view:

        <select id="sel_month" name="sel_month" style="width: 100%;" >
                            <option value="1" <?php echo set_select('sel_month', '1', isEqual($data['sel_month'], '1')); ?> >Январь</option>
                            <option value="2" <?php echo set_select('sel_month', '2', isEqual($data['sel_month'], '2')); ?> >Февраль</option>
                            <option value="3" <?php echo set_select('sel_month', '3', isEqual($data['sel_month'], '3')); ?> >Март</option>
                            <option value="4" <?php echo set_select('sel_month', '4', isEqual($data['sel_month'], '4')); ?> >Апрель</option>
                            <option value="5" <?php echo set_select('sel_month', '5', isEqual($data['sel_month'], '5')); ?> >Май</option>
                            <option value="6" <?php echo set_select('sel_month', '6', isEqual($data['sel_month'], '6')); ?> >Июнь</option>
                            <option value="7" <?php echo set_select('sel_month', '7', isEqual($data['sel_month'], '7')); ?> >Июль</option>
                            <option value="8" <?php echo set_select('sel_month', '8', isEqual($data['sel_month'], '8')); ?> >Август</option>
                            <option value="9" <?php echo set_select('sel_month', '9', isEqual($data['sel_month'], '9')); ?> >Сентябрь</option>
                            <option value="10" <?php echo set_select('sel_month', '10', isEqual($data['sel_month'], '10')); ?> >Октябрь</option>
                            <option value="11" <?php echo set_select('sel_month', '11', isEqual($data['sel_month'], '11')); ?> >Ноябрь</option>
                            <option value="12" <?php echo set_select('sel_month', '12', isEqual($data['sel_month'], '12')); ?> >Декабрь</option>
                        </select>


        Быдлить, так по взрослому :)
        Ответить
    • Нулябрь, же!
      Ответить

    Добавить комментарий